Ex-Michigan quarterback Tom Brady completed 21-of-29 passes for 326 yards and four touchdowns to four different receivers as the battle of the AFC East leaders turned into a blowout in New England with the Patriots pummeling the New York Jets 45-to-3.
New England raced out to a 17-0 lead in the first quarter and never looked back to improve its record to 10-and-2, which is tops in the NFL along with the Atlanta Falcons. It was the Jet’s first road loss of the season as they fall to 9-and-3.
